Not the sideways pic thing again. Not much of a story. I was about to get out of the treestand until I heard some twigs snap. A few cows and a calf worked their way in. I was gonna wait to see if there was a bull in the rear but didn't want to pass up my first opportunity. Hit her in the heart and she ran only about 20-30 yards. Lots of work taking care of meat all day. Well worth it though.
